Bathroom Suite vs Wet Room: What's Right for You?
When it comes to modernizing your bathroom, the choice between a traditional shower room and a spacious wet room can be tough. Both choices offer unique benefits and drawbacks, so it's crucial to thoroughly consider your needs before making a decision.
- Traditional showers typically features a fixed shower unit and a individual section for other toiletries, like a washbasin. This arrangement offers clear separation between wet and dry sections, making it a practical option for compact layouts.
- Wet rooms, on the other hand, abolish the traditional shower stall, creating a flowing space. The entire shower area is graded to drain smoothly, allowing for a contemporary aesthetic. This choice is particularly perfect for larger bathrooms where optimizing floor area is a priority.
In conclusion, the best choice between a bathroom suite and a open shower relies on your specific requirements. Consider factors like bathroom size, cost considerations, lifestyle, and design style to determine the alternative that best aligns with your goals.

To begin your garage conversion journey in Manchester, here are a few things to consider:
* **Your budget:** Garage conversions can range in cost depending on the size and scope of the project. It's important to have a clear idea of how much you're willing to spend before you begin.
* **Planning permission:** You may need planning permission from your local council before you can start work on your garage conversion.
* **Choosing the right contractor:** Finding a reputable and experienced contractor is essential for a successful project. Make sure to get several quotes and check references before making your decision.
